This generation of the Ford Falcon was produced by the American manufacturer Ford between 1963 - 1965. It's a front engined rear-wheel drive car and came as a coupé, saloon or estate. There are many power levels available from either a 2.4 L Inline 6 petrol engine or 4.3 L V8 petrol engine. It has double wishbone front suspension and live axle rear suspension.
Performance Pick
If you're interested in performance, the best performance version of the Falcon is the Ford Falcon Sprint 289 V8 which scores 2.3★ on the encyCARpedia Rating system for performance. With total power at 200 BHP and a power/weight ratio of 152 BHP/Tonne it has a top speed of 114 mph and gets to 62 mph in 8.9 seconds.
Practicality Pick
If you're more interested in practicality, then the Ford Falcon 170 Station Wagon is the best practical all-rounder with a score of 3.5★ on the encyCARpedia Rating system for practicality. It has a range of 268 miles and can store 850-2,150 litres of cargo.
